API 510 Section 4 Questions and Answers Rated A+ Who is responsible to ensure that all of the requirements of API 510 are met? a) AI b) jurisdiction c) manufacturer d) owner/user e) pressure vessel engineer f) pressure equipment department manager d) Who is responsible to ensure that the Authorized Inspection Agency functions in accordance with the requirements of API 510? a) AI b) jurisdiction c) owner/user d) pressure vessel engineer e) pressure equipment department manager c) Each owner/user that uses API 510 must: a) maintain a quality assurance inspection manual b) employ (direct-hire) at least one pressure equipment engineer c) maintain an "R" stamp for vessel repairs d) employ (direct-hire) at least one qualified welder who can make repairs to pressure vessels a) Which of the following is not required to be in the owner/user's quality assurance inspection manual? a) training requirements for inspection personnel b) calibration of NDE equipment c) directions on how to document inspection results d) specify approval process for calculations performed during vessel alterations e) establish vacation policy for authorized inspectors e) Which of the following is not a role for the API 510 inspector? a) provide the owner/user assurance that all welding meet requirements b) provide the owner/user assurance that all NDE examinations meet requirements c) provide the owner/user assurance that all inspections meet requirements d) provide the owner/user assurance that all pressure testing meet requirements a) During in-service vessel repairs, all examination results must be accepted by the: a) NDE supervisor b) AI c) pressure vessel engineer d) repair org b)
